Important differences between pilaf and true morels

  • Pilaf has more selenium, folate, vitamin B1, vitamin B3, vitamin B6, and manganese; however, true morels are richer in iron, copper, and vitamin D.
  • True morels' daily need coverage for iron is 122% more.
  • Pilaf contains 62 times more sodium than true morels. Pilaf contains 1303mg of sodium, while true morels contain 21mg.
  • Pilaf has a higher glycemic index. The glycemic index of pilaf is 60, while the glycemic index of true morels is 32.

The food varieties used in the comparison are Rice and vermicelli mix, rice pilaf flavor, unprepared and Mushrooms, morel, raw.
